Subject: [Snort-sigs] Changing the Community sid-msg.map
Date: Thu, 17 Nov 2005 10:49:00 -0500
In response to multiple requests from users, we here at Sourcefire are considering making a small change to the format of Community rulepacks: we'd like to change the name of sid-msg.map to community-sid-msg.map. This would eliminate the naming conflict with sid-msg.map from the VRT rule set. Before we do so, though, we wanted to check with the community at large, to ensure that this change won't break anyone's scripts/tools/etc. If you know of any problems this would cause, please let us know now, so that we can work with you to prevent such problems while still eliminating this conflict.
